      I spent a few minutes scanning the Help -> Help Contents pull down menu option; I couldn't see the Fuse IDE help.

      Turns out I was reading the start of each line in a tree with about 12-15 items; given the last few words are not terribly useful ("e.g. User Guide / Manual / Documentation) my eyes were naturally scanning the first few words of each row which tends to be descriptive - e.g. "Mylyn...., JAX-WS...., Java dev....".

      I totally missed the Fuse IDE help as Fuse IDE is mentioned right in the middle of the sentence. I think it'll be easier to spot the Fuse IDE stuff if we start with just "Fuse IDE for Camel" or even "Fuse IDE for Camel User Guide" or something.
